International Summit Addresses Climate Change Challenges
World leaders gather to discuss urgent climate change initiatives at the annual summit, focusing on innovative solutions and collaborative efforts.

Representatives from numerous countries convened at the annual International Climate Change Summit this week, aiming to tackle pressing environmental challenges. The event, hosted in London, brought together heads of state, climate activists, and scientists to engage in discussions on sustainable practices.

Debate shifted towards the effectiveness of existing policies and the need for urgent action. Participants highlighted the pressing threat of climate change, emphasising that collaborative efforts are essential.

Experts presented innovative technologies aimed at reducing carbon emissions. For example, solar and wind energy advancements have made strides in feasibility and accessibility, which could play a crucial role in global energy transitions.

A significant point of discussion was investment in greener technologies. Key stakeholders suggested that increased funding could accelerate the shift towards renewable energy sources. "Investing in sustainable solutions is not just vital for the environment; it is also economically beneficial," stated a climate economist during a panel discussion.

In addition to technological advancements, the summit featured workshops focused on community-led initiatives. Grassroots movements were encouraged to take part in creating local solutions tailored to specific regional challenges.

Global agreements were a pivotal topic, with multiple countries expressing their commitment to the Paris Agreement. The accord aims to limit global warming to well below 2 degrees Celsius, with a goal of pursuing efforts to limit the temperature increase to 1.5 degrees Celsius.

As the summit concluded, participants left with a renewed determination to implement actionable strategies to combat climate change, urging nations to collaborate more closely. The outcome of the discussions may set the agenda for future policies and initiatives aiming to confront the climate crisis head-on.

The International Climate Change Summit underscores a critical juncture in the approach to global environmental issues, emphasising that continued dialogue and action are imperative as climate impacts become increasingly evident across the globe.
